Mississippi is one among solely 13 states that tax groceries, and at 7%, the state’s tax is the very best within the nation.

Grocery taxes solely proceed to burden low-income folks, which compounds one other drawback of meals insecurity: Mississippi has the very best meals insecurity charge within the nation, in response to 2020 knowledge supplied by Feeding America.

Mississippi, the poorest state, additionally has one of many highest gross sales tax charges throughout the board, matching Indiana, Rhode Island and Tennessee. California has the very best gross sales tax of seven.25%.

The controversy on whether or not or to not minimize Mississippi’s grocery tax has continued for years, with late politician Alan Nunnelee calling the 7% tax “essentially the most merciless tax any authorities can impose” way back to 2007.

As Bobby Harrison reported in a 2020 evaluation, Vice President for State Fiscal Coverage Michael Leachman of the Middle on Price range and Coverage Priorities argued that Mississippi — the primary state to impose a modern-day gross sales tax — did so due to race, at the very least partially.

To cite Harrison, “Even when Mississippi politicians are given an enormous advantage of the doubt on the difficulty of race that historical past tells us they won’t deserve, it’s honest to imagine {that a} excessive share of individuals whom [former Gov. Mike] Connor was referencing as paying no taxes had been African American. In spite of everything, due to the upper ranges of poverty amongst Black residents, they’d then and have now much less property and revenue to tax.

Lots of the states the place the upper gross sales taxes could be discovered are within the South. And solely three states levy as a lot gross sales tax on meals as they do on different retail objects. Two of these are also Southern states — Mississippi and Alabama — with the opposite being South Dakota.”

As of 2022, the variety of states that levy their full gross sales tax on meals is now seven: Alabama, Hawaii, Idaho, Kansas, Mississippi, Oklahoma and South Dakota.

Elected officers, although they focus on the potential of reducing the grocery tax, have constantly said that revenue tax is their precedence.
